Abstract
The paper aims to investigate the relationship between cerebrovascular morphology and hemodynmaics in order to predict rupture and creation of cerebral aneurysms. The authors have been developing an image-based simulation system together with a database system. Using 19 cases of the middle cerebral artery (MCA) analysis from the database system, the multiple regression analysis is performed to estimate a maximum value of wall shear stress. The results are compared and show good agreement with those of numerical analyses.
